一种Bayer滤波阵列彩色相机图像非均匀性校正方法

文档序号:7892792阅读:375来源:国知局
专利名称:一种Bayer滤波阵列彩色相机图像非均匀性校正方法
技术领域
本发明涉及一种相机图像非均匀性校正,尤其涉及一种Bayer滤波阵列彩色相机图像非均匀性校正方法
背景技术
随着光电传感器件性能和可靠性提高,以CCD、CMOS光电探测器为基础的成像系统已广泛应用于工业检测、军工国防、空间观测等领域。以光电探测器为基础的相机在均匀光源照射下,输出图像每个像元灰度值理论上应该完全相同,但事实上各像元输出会有差异,造成相机图像这种像元灰度非均匀性的主要原因有以下几个方面(I)相机镜头光学系统中cos4因素,即光轴外像点光照度随视场角余弦的四次方而降低;(2)相机探测器生产工艺等因素造成像元响应固有非均匀性;(3)相机机械装配等原因造成相机成像非均匀性。在相机实际应用中,特别是在目标观测和高精度的测量中,相机成像不均匀性引起的图像条纹、亮暗不均会给观测图像质量带来较大的影响,对测量结果带来较大误差。为了提高图像质量和测量精度,必须对相机图像不均匀性进行校正。目前广泛采用的单通道黑白相机图像非均匀校正方法有单点校正法、两点校正法、多点拟合校正法等。针对Bayer滤波阵列彩色相机而言,不同于单通道的黑白相机图像,Bayer滤波阵列彩色相机图像分为R、G、B三个通道,每一个像素点都只有一种颜色通道灰度值,如图I所示。因此单通道黑白相机图像现有校正方法不能直接应用于Bayer滤波阵列彩色相机,而且现有校正方法在相机对光强响应为线性时,具有较高精度,但实际工程中,相机对光强响应往往并不是绝对线性的,采用传统方法对图像非均匀性进行校正没有考虑到相机对光照强度响应的非线性造成的校正误差。专利CN 100458380C中公开了一种基于Wiener滤波理论的非制冷红外焦平面非均匀校正算法,但未考虑非均匀图像按不同通道、不同灰度值区间图像各像素间非均匀校正。专利CN 102176742A中公开了一种图像校正系数的获取方法,非均匀图像校正方法及系统,提出将探测器阵列进行分组,利用每两组图像均值之差平方和最小准则获取校正参数,但未涉及各组图像内部非均匀性。上述两项专利技术均未涉及Bayer滤波阵列彩色相机图像非均匀性校正。

发明内容
本发明解决的技术问题是提供一种Bayer滤波阵列彩色相机图像非均匀性校正方法。该方法首先解决了传统单通道黑白相机图像非均匀性校正方法无法直接应用于Bayer滤波阵列彩色相机图像的问题,同时降低了相机对光照响应为非线性所造成的图像非均匀校正误差,从而提高了图像非均匀性校正的精度。本发明技术方案如下
一种Bayer滤波阵列彩色相机图像非均匀性校正方法,其特征在于该方法包括如下步骤(I)获取Bayer滤波阵列彩色相机在均勻光照下的N幅Bayer格式图像IMGn(η =
1,2,……,N);(2)将步骤⑴获取的Bayer格式图像MGn分解为三幅图像,分别对应红(R)、绿(G)、蓝(B)三通道颜色,并按图像灰度均值将各图像进行分组,计算出相机图像非均匀校正系数PAR ; (3)应用校正系数PAR对Bayer滤波阵列彩色相机图像进行非均匀性校正。所述步骤(I)具体为获取Bayer滤波阵列彩色相机在不同光照强度的均匀光照下的N幅Bayer格式图像IMGn(η = 1,2,……,N),其中N幅Bayer格式图像IMGn对应N级光照强度,且覆盖了图像灰度范围。所述步骤⑵具体为a、首先将Bayer格式图像数据MGn按所属通道分解为R通道图像IMG、6通道图像IMG〖4通道图像IMG;b、计算R通道图像IMG灰度均值,根据大小将R通道图像IMG划分为M组,分别对应图像M段灰度区间范围;c、在M段灰度区间内,分段计算各灰度区间的非均匀定标校正系数PAR= (m = 1,2,……,M),其中¥AKRm=[aRmX],各灰度区间可采用的非均匀校正系数获取方法包括单点法、两点法、多点拟合法之一 ;d、同理可得G、B通道PAR=、PAR^。则Bayer格式相机图像非均匀校正系数PAR 包括 PAR=,PAR 二 PAR^。所述步骤(3)具体为a、针对Bayer滤波阵列彩色相机待校正图像MG_P,首先将IMG_P分解为R、G、B三通道图像PARK,PARg, PARb。贝UPAR=(Xj)表示頂G_P的红色(R)通道图像PARk中坐标为(x,y)的像素点灰度值,且灰度值属于第m段灰度区间。根据图像各像素灰度值,选择与之对应的灰度区间范围的校正系数进行分段校正,校正公式为
_ 8] ΙΜδ—PmR (x,y) =4 · IMG—PmR (x,y)+b^其中ΙΜδ—P= (x,y)为校正之后的红色(R)通道图像ΙΜδ—PR*坐标为(x,y)的像素点灰度值山、同理对待校正图像MG_P的G、B通道图像MG_Pe、MG_PB进行校正,得到非均匀校正之后G、B通道图像ΙΜδ—Pg、ΙΜδ—ΡΒ; C、将ΙΜδ—Pr,ΙΜδ—Pg,ΙΜδ—Pb合成得到非均匀校正之后图像ΙΜδ—P。本发明的技术结果本发明所述方法通过将均匀光照下Bayer格式图像分解为R、G、B三通道图像,并且分别计算图像不同灰度区间的校正系数,从而对待校正的非均匀图像按不同通道、不同灰度值区间分别进行图像各像素非均匀校正。本发明首先解决了传统单通道黑白相机图像非均匀性校正方法无法直接应用于Bayer滤波阵列彩色相机图像的问题,同时提高了相机对光照强度响应为非线性时,图像非均匀性校正的精度。


图I为Bayer滤波阵列彩色相机图像R、G、B三通道数据的一种排列方式。图2为应用本发明所述方法获取Bayer滤波阵列彩色相机图像非均匀校正系数流程图。
图3为将均匀光照下Bayer格式图像頂G1分解为三IMGf、IMGf、IMGf通道图像。其中A、图像MG1 ;B、红色通道图像IMGf ;C、红色通道图像IMGf ;D、红色通道图像IMGf。 图4为应用本发明所述方法对Bayer滤波阵列彩色相机待校正图像进行非均匀校正流程图。图5 为IMGf、IMGf、IMGf 经校正后的图像ΙΜδ—Pf、IMG P10 > IMG Pf,
并合成Bayer格式图像ΙΜδ—P1。其中Α、为校正后红通道图像ΙΜδ—Rr ; B、为校正后绿通道图像ΙΜδ—Pf ; C、为校正后蓝通道图像ΙΜδ—Pf ; D、为校正后三通道图像合成Bayer格式图
像 ΙΜδ—P1 O图6为IMG1的三通道图像校正前、经现有方法校正后、经本发明方法校正后,中间一行像素灰度值曲线图。其中Α、红通道图像校正前、经现有方法校正后、经本发明方法校正后,第432行像素灰度值曲线;Β、绿通道图像校正前、经现有方法校正后、经本发明方法校正后,第864行像素灰度值曲线;C、蓝通道图像校正前、经现有方法校正后、经本发明方法校正后,第432行像素灰度值曲线。
具体实施例方式下面结合附图和具体实施例,对本发明方法进一步说明。本实施例Bayer滤波阵列彩色相机图像像素分辨率为2352 1728,灰度范围为O到255,图像R、G、B三通道数据的排列方式如图I所示。应用本发明所述方法对Bayer滤波阵列彩色相机图像非均匀性进行校正包括以下几个步骤(I)获取Bayer滤波阵列彩色相机在均勻光照下的N幅Bayer格式图像IMGn(η =
1,2,……,N) ο本实施例中,取N = 4,则共获取4幅Bayer滤波阵列彩色相机在均匀光照下图像。(2)获取的Bayer格式图像MGn分解为三幅图像,分别对应红(R)、绿(G)、蓝(B)三通道颜色,并按图像灰度均值将各图像进行分组,计算出相机图像非均匀校正系数PAR。本实施例中,应用本发明所述方法获取Bayer滤波阵列彩色相机图像非均匀校正系数流程如图2所示。将IMGn按所属通道分解为R通道图像IMG、G通道图像IMG〖、B通道图像IMG ,如图3所示为IMG1分解为IMGf、IMGf、IMGf,像素分辨率分别为1176X864、1176X1728,1176X864 ;计算各图像灰度均值,以R通道图像为例,计算得R通道图像灰度均值,根据 大小将R通道图像IMG划分为M组,本实施例中,取M = 2,且e
时,IMG^
属于第I组,e[128,255]时,IMG=属于第2组。则本实施例中,根据大小,划分IMGf、IMG〖为第I组,IMG、IMG〖为第2组;采用两点法分别计算2段灰度区间的图像非均匀定标校正系数PARf、PARf,其中PARf = [af, bf ] ,PAR^ =[々2β ]。同理可得G、B通道PARf,PARf , PAR^, PARf。则Bayer格式相机图像总体非均匀校正系数 PAR 包括PARf,PAR^, PARf,PAR^, PAR , PARf。(3)应用校正系数PAR对Bayer滤波阵列彩色相机图像进行非均匀性校正。本实施例中,应用本发明所述方法对Bayer滤波阵列彩色相机图像进行非均匀性校正流程如图4所不。对Bayer滤波阵列彩色相机待校正图像MG_P,首先将MG_P分解为R、G、B三通道图像 MG_PK,IMG_Pg, IMG_Pb0 则IMG—P= (x,_y)表示 MG_P 的红色(R)通道图像 MG_PK 中坐标为(x,y)的像素点灰度值,且灰度值属于第m段灰度区间。根据图像各像素灰度值,选 择与之对应的灰度区间范围的校正系数进行分段校正,校正公式为IMg—PmR (x,y) =< · IMG—PmR (x,y)+b^其中ΙΜδ—P= (x,y)为校正之后的红色(R)通道图像ΙΜδ—PR*坐标为(x,y)的像素点灰度值;同理对待校正图像頂的G、B通道图像MG_Pe、IMG_PB进行校正,得到非均匀校正之后G、B通道图像ΙΜδ—P°、IMG Pb ο将ΙΜδ—Pr、IMG Pg > ΙΜδ—Pb合成得到非均匀校正之后图像ΙΜδ—P,如图5所示为IMG—P1' IMG—P1' IMG—Pf经校正后的图像ΙΜδ—Rr、IMG P10、ΙΜδ—Pf并合成图像ΙΜδ—P1。如图6所示为IMG1的三通道图像校正前、经现有方法校正后、经本发明方法校正后,中间一行像素灰度值曲线图。本发明未详述部分属于本技术领域的公知技术。以上所述仅为本发明的具体实例而已,并不用于以限制本发明,凡在本发明的精神和原则之内所作的任何修改、等同替换和改进等,均应包含在本发明的保护范围之内。
权利要求
1.一种Bayer滤波阵列彩色相机图像非均匀性校正方法,其特征在于该方法包括如下步骤 (1)获取Bayer滤波阵列彩色相机在均勻光照下的N幅Bayer格式图像IMGn,其中η=1,2,……,N; (2)将步骤⑴获取的Bayer格式图像頂Gn分解为三幅图像,分别对应红(R)、绿(G)、蓝(B)三通道颜色,并按图像灰度均值将各图像进行分组,计算出相机图像非均匀校正系数 PAR; (3)应用校正系数PAR对Bayer滤波阵列彩色相机图像进行非均匀性校正。
2.根据权利要求I所述的Bayer滤波阵列彩色相机图像非均匀性校正方法,其特征在于所述步骤(I)具体为获取Bayer滤波阵列彩色相机在不同光照强度的均匀光照下的N幅Bayer格式图像IMGn,η = 1,2,……,N,其中N幅Bayer格式图像IMGn对应N级光照强度,且覆盖了图像灰度范围。
3.根据权利要求I所述的Bayer滤波阵列彩色相机图像非均匀性校正方法,其特征在于所述步骤(2)具体为 a、首先将Bayer格式图像数据IMGn按所属通道分解为R通道图像IMG、G通道图像IMGn0、B通道图像IMG;; b、计算R通道图像IMG灰度均值gmy,根据gray大小将R通道图像IMG划分为M组,分别对应图像M段灰度区间范围; C、在M段灰度区间内,分段计算各灰度区间的非均匀定标校正系数PAR^m= 1,2,……,M,其中PAR=,各灰度区间可采用的非均匀校正系数获取方法包括单点法、两点法、多点拟合法; d、同理可得G、B通道PAR=,PAR^,则Bayer格式相机图像非均匀校正系数PAR包括PAR:, PAR^, PAR^o
4.根据权利要求I所述的Bayer滤波阵列彩色相机图像非均匀性校正方法,其特征在于所述步骤(3)具体为 a、针对Bayer滤波阵列彩色相机待校正图像MG_P,首先将MG_P分解为R、G、B三通道图像MG_PK,IMG_Pg, MG_Pb,则IMG—P=(x,>0表示頂G_P的红色(R)通道图像MG_PK中坐标为(X,y)的像素点灰度值,且灰度值属于第m段灰度区间,根据图像各像素灰度值,选择与之对应的灰度区间范围的校正系数进行分段校正,校正公式为IMG_PmR (x,y) =a: · IMG—P: (x,y)+b: 其中ΙΜδ—P=(x,y)为校正之后的红色(R)通道图像ΙΜδ—PR*坐标为(x,y)的像素点灰度值; b、同理对待校正图像MG_P的G、B通道图像MG_Pe、IMG_PB进行校正,得到非均匀校正之后G、B通道图像ΙΜδ—PG,IMG_Pb ; C、将ΙΜδ—ΡΒ,ΙΜδ—P°,ΙΜδ—Pb合成得到非均匀校正之后图像ΙΜδ—P。
全文摘要
一种Bayer滤波阵列彩色相机图像非均匀性校正方法,步骤包括(1)获取Bayer滤波阵列彩色相机在均匀光照下的多幅Bayer格式图像;(2)将获取的均匀光照下的Bayer格式图像分解为三幅图像,分别对应红(R)、绿(G)、蓝(B)三通道颜色,并按图像灰度均值将各图像进行分组,计算出相机图像非均匀校正系数;(3)应用获取的校正系数对Bayer滤波阵列彩色相机图像进行非均匀性校正。该方法首先解决了传统单通道黑白相机图像非均匀性校正方法无法直接应用于Bayer滤波阵列彩色相机图像的问题,同时降低了相机对光照响应为非线性所造成的图像非均匀校正误差,从而提高了图像非均匀性校正的精度。
文档编号H04N9/64GK102622739SQ20121009088
公开日2012年8月1日 申请日期2012年3月30日 优先权日2012年3月30日
发明者余国彬, 刘恩海, 周向东, 周武林, 王进, 赵汝进, 钟杰, 陈元培 申请人:中国科学院光电技术研究所
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1